MOTOROLA

SEMICONDUCTOR TECHNICAL DATA

Order this document by BD165/D

Plastic Medium Power Silicon

NPN Transistor

. . . designed for use as audio amplifiers and drivers utilizing complementary or quasi complementary circuits.

DC Current Gain Ð h FE = 40 (Min) @ IC = 0.15 Adc

BD 165, 169 are complementary with BD 166, 168, 170

BD165

BD169

1.5 AMPERE

POWER TRANSISTORS

NPN SILICON

45, 60, 80 VOLTS

20 WATTS

Note 1:

There are two limitations on the power handling ability of a transistor; average junction temperature and second breakdown. Safe operating area curves indicate IC ± VCE limits of the transistor that must be observed for reliable operation; i.e., the transistor must not be subjected to greater dissipation than the curves indicate.

The data of Figure 2 is based on TJ(pk) = 150_C; TC is variable depending on conditions. Second breakdown pulse

limits are valid for duty cycles to 10% provided TJ(pk) v 150_C. At high case temperatures, thermal limitations will

reduce the power that can be handled to values less than the limitations imposed by second breakdown.
